Gaining the nickname ‘Magic’ early in his karting career due to his name being equally unpronounceable and unspellable, Maciej was originally born in Poland before moving to the United States at a young age. Discovering karting across the pond, Maciej moved to the UK at the age of 10 and spent a frustrating youth competing in British and European karting on a shoestring budget with his father. Managing to scoop up two championships despite his equipment horrors, his family’s impending financial ruin persuaded him to study a master’s degree in Motorsport Engineering at Oxford Brookes University.
During this time, he began writing for Autosport and Motorsport News rather than focusing on his coursework. Despite this, he currently works full-time in F1 but isn’t allowed to disclose his workplace, as part of his agreement that allows him to continue his journalism work. Unfortunately for both his wallet and sanity, he hasn’t been able to cure himself of his racing driver delusions and plans to compete in the Formula Vee championship with the 750 Motor Club.
Away from the track, Maciej enjoys reading on a variety of subjects ranging from Japanese history to supersonic passenger jets. He dreams of one day becoming a successful motorsport presenter as well as a respected author, not only of motorsport books but also of science fiction novels for which he plans to use a pen name.
